right. The Makefile controls what components get compiled into Asterisk. If you remove one from the Makefile it will not attempt to build taht module (and its resulting functionality) into Asterisk on your system. So if you remove the TDS module, the result will be your Asterisk will not have TDS support, but your system’s TDS will be left alone.

If you need this functionality in the future you can upgrade your TDS packages and then recompile * with a fresh Makefile.

those can be safely ignored.

the first two are not even warnings. the ignoring signalling bit just means either 1. you have defined signalling= more that once and one is being ignored, or that you only reloaded asterisk and signalling changes need a restart. the last one means you don’t have a Digium TC400B Codec Offload Board and thus no zaptel-based transcoding is available (which is fine because asterisk can transcode on its own).
